The example in this article describes the method of converting word to HTML in PHP. I share it with you for your reference, the details are as follows:
If you want to perfectly solve the problem of converting office to pdf or html, it is best to use windows office software. Libreoffice cannot convert perfectly, and wps does not have an API.
First confirm whether the com module is enabled. If there is a com_dotnet module in phpinfo, it means it is enabled. If not, modify php.ini,
Copy the code The code is as follows:
com.allow_dcom = true
If it is not a built-in module, add it to php.ini, provided that you have the extension in your ext folder
Copy the codeThe code is as follows:
extension=php_com_dotnet.dll
function word2html($wordname,$htmlname) { $word = new COM("word.application") or die("Unable to instanciate Word"); $word->Visible = 1; $word->Documents->Open($wordname); $word->Documents[1]->SaveAs($htmlname,8); $word->Quit(); $word = null; unset($word); } word2html('D:/www/test/6.docx','D:/www/test/6.html');
Note:
1. Check the source code of the converted HTML, it is quite messy
2. Winword.exe will be called during the conversion process
3. If the page keeps loading, rename the document and then re- change.
